AM Best Comments on Credit Ratings of Certain Group 1001 Insurance Holdings, LLC Subsidiaries Following Ransomware Attack

OLDWICK, N.J.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--AM Best has commented that the Credit Ratings (ratings) of certain Group 1001 Insurance Holdings, LLC’s rated subsidiaries remain unchanged following the parent company’s disclosure that it sustained a cybersecurity attack that caused a network disruption and impacted certain systems.

According to the company, the following subsidiaries experienced system interruptions but are now back to full functionality: Delaware Life Insurance Company, Delaware Life Insurance Company of New York, Clear Spring Life and Annuity Company and Clear Spring Property and Casualty Company.

AM Best was notified of a cyber security ransomware attack that occurred against Group 1001 beginning in early February. Group 1001 has engaged with law enforcement and regulatory agencies following the attack. Group 1001 did not pay the ransomware and believes all systems have been cleaned and validated. Currently, Group 1001 believes the impact to business interruption was minimal and currently day-to-day operations have resumed as normal.

AM Best currently believes that the disruption caused by the ransomware attack has not reached a level that is material to the credit profile of the enterprise. AM Best recognizes that the situation remains highly fluid and will continue to monitor developments.
